About

Bing Li is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Bing Li has authored 216 papers receiving a total of 3.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 60 papers in Epidemiology, 59 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 42 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Bing Li's work include Mycobacterium research and diagnosis (29 papers), Lung Cancer Treatments and Mutations (26 papers) and Tuberculosis Research and Epidemiology (23 papers). Bing Li is often cited by papers focused on Mycobacterium research and diagnosis (29 papers), Lung Cancer Treatments and Mutations (26 papers) and Tuberculosis Research and Epidemiology (23 papers). Bing Li coll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Germany. Bing Li's co-authors include Haiqing Chu, Zhemin Zhang, Liyun Xu, Minjie Sheng, Weifang Wang, Shengxiang Ren, Meiping Ye, Qi Guo, Meihua Gao and Lan Zhao and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, Journal of Clinical Oncology and Blood.
